Dr. Deepshikha Thakur is a leading researcher in human-robot interaction and assistive technologies for neurodevelopmental disorders, with a particular focus on autism spectrum disorder (ASD). Her most cited work, a 2017 study protocol for the Kaspar RCT, represents a landmark contribution to the field by addressing the critical gap in rigorous, randomised controlled trials for robot-assisted social skills therapy. This feasibility study laid the groundwork for evidence-based interventions using humanoid robots to improve social communication in children with ASD, demonstrating her commitment to methodological rigor in a field often characterised by small-scale studies. With over 50 citations, this protocol has shaped subsequent research directions and clinical applications.
